The National Bank team achieved a dear victory over Ismaily, 2-0, in the match that brought them together, this evening, Wednesday, in the Egyptian Premier League competition.
The Al-Ahly and Ismaili Bank match was held at Cairo International Stadium, as part of the 28th round of the Premier League.
Karim Bamboo opened the scoring for Al-Ahly Bank in the 35th minute, then Mohamed Hilal added the second goal in the 63rd minute from a penalty kick.
With this result, the National Bank escapes from the relegation centers temporarily, after it rose to the fifteenth place, with 28 points, one point behind Ismaili, who ranked fourteenth, and stopped at 29 points.
This is Ismaili’s second defeat in the last 10 league matches, noting that he beat Zamalek in the last round with two goals to one.
Match details:
The National Bank entered the match with a squad consisting of: “Muhammad Abu Jabal, Saido Simboori, Amir Medhat, Yaqobu, Muhammad Bassiouni, Muhammad Fathi, Mahmoud Sayed, Muhammad Hilal, Mahmoud Qaoud, Ahmed Yasser, Karim Bamboo.”
The Ismaili formation came as follows: “Ahmed Adel, Muhammad Hashem, Muhammad Nasr, Essam Sobhi, Muhammad Desouki, Sergey Aka, Imad Hamdi, Ahmed Madbouly, Karim Al-Deeb, Muhammad Abdel Samie, Muhammad Al-Shami.”
Ismaily started the match quickly, carrying out an organized attack in the second minute, which ended with a dangerous cross from Ahmed Madbouly from the left, but was caught by goalkeeper Mohamed Abu Jabal.
The most dangerous opportunity came in the first minutes from Al-Ahly Bank, after a missile shot by Mahmoud Bassiouni, but it was blocked by Ismaili goalkeeper Ahmed Adel, and the ball went out to a corner kick in the sixth minute.
In the 16th minute, the National Bank succeeded in advancing the first goal through Saido Simbori, before the video technology intervened and decided to cancel the goal due to the infiltration of Muhammad Hilal.
Mahmoud Al-Sayed, the Al-Ahly Bank player, had a dangerous opportunity in the 33rd minute, after he fired a powerful shot from inside the penalty area, but it went over the goal.
The 35th minute witnessed the first goal in the match in favor of Al-Ahly Bank, after a wonderful cross from Muhammad Hilal, and Karim Bamboo met it with a wonderful header, to enter the window of Abu Jabal, so that the score became 1-0.
The events of the first half of the match ended with Al-Ahly Bank ahead of Ismaily, 1-0.
In the 59th minute, Ibrahim Noureddine awarded a penalty kick in favor of Al-Ismaili after blocking Karim Bamboo inside the penalty area, and video technology confirmed the validity of the violation.
Mohamed Hilal hit the penalty kick brilliantly, to score the second goal of the National Bank in the Ismaili window in the 63rd minute, making the score 2-0.
Muhammad Abu Jabal, the goalkeeper of the National Bank, blocked a powerful shot from Ismaili in the 91st minute, to keep his net clean.
Al-Ahly Bank maintained its two-goal lead over Ismaily until the end of the match, to score three precious points in the league.
